Matiganj is a Rural village located in Ratua-i, Malda, West-bengal.

The total population of Matiganj is 2,112.

Matiganj village comprises 454 households.

The literacy rate in Matiganj is 66.5%. Among the literate population of 1,199, there are 664 literate males and 535 literate females.

In Matiganj, there are 1,062 males and 1,050 females, with a sex ratio of 989 females per 1000 males.

There are 308 children (14.6% of population), comprising 150 boys and 158 girls.

The total number of workers in Matiganj is 1,252, with 586 main workers and 666 marginal workers.

In Matiganj, there are 397 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(202 males, 195 females) and 1 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 1 females).

Matiganj is located in West-bengal state, Malda district, and falls under Ratua-i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 312397 and LGD code is 312397.
